Christina of Sweden (1626–1689) was queen from 1632 to 1654 and a striking figure of seventeenth‑century Europe. Heir to Gustavus II Adolphus, she ascended the throne as a child and grew up under the regency of Axel Oxenstierna, receiving a humanist, multilingual education that made her a voracious reader and a cultivated intellectual.
During her reign she pursued cultural and political ambitions, seeking to transform Stockholm into the “Athens of the North.” Known for her interest in manuscripts, science, alchemy and theatre, Christina promoted scholarship and adopted a lifestyle unusual for a monarch of her time.
In 1654 she abdicated in favor of her cousin Charles X Gustav and converted to Catholicism, a decision that sparked scandal in Protestant Sweden and prompted her departure for Italy. Settled in Rome, she became a patron of the arts, supporting musicians, playwrights and cultural projects until her death.
Christina’s memory endures both for her political role — the unexpected abdication and religious break — and for her cultural legacy: a figure who challenged gender norms and became an icon for literary, theatrical and musical works.
